How Pregnancy Changes Your Body

As your baby grows, your body experiences a combination of structural and hormonal changes designed to support a healthy pregnancy. These changes, while normal, often create discomfort that leads many women to seek chiropractic care.

1. Hormonal Shifts

During pregnancy, your body releases a hormone called relaxin, which softens ligaments to prepare for childbirth. While necessary, this increased looseness can cause joint instability, especially in the hips, pelvis, and lower back.

2. Shifting Center of Gravity

As the belly grows, your posture changes. You naturally start leaning backward to compensate for the added weight, which puts extra pressure on the spine and surrounding muscles.

3. Pelvic and Low Back Strain

The combination of weight gain, postural shifts, and loosened ligaments often leads to:

  • Lower back pain

  • Hip discomfort

  • Sciatica

  • Pelvic misalignment

  • Round ligament pain

In fact, 50–70% of pregnant women experience back pain during pregnancy. For many women, that’s a big reason to explore supportive, conservative care like chiropractic.

Is Chiropractic Care Safe During Pregnancy?

Yes, chiropractic care is generally very safe during pregnancy when performed by a chiropractor trained in prenatal techniques. These professionals understand how to adjust the spine and pelvis without putting pressure on the abdomen or using forceful twisting.

Prenatal chiropractors also use special equipment and techniques, such as:

  • Pregnancy pillows with belly space for comfort

  • Drop tables that make adjustments gentle

  • Webster Technique, a specialized method focused on pelvic balance

  • Modified positions to prevent strain on the uterus or ligaments

Many OBGYNs and midwives regularly refer their patients to chiropractors for natural pain relief and improved pelvic function.

What to Expect at a Prenatal Chiropractic Appointment

If you’ve never been to a chiropractor, especially during pregnancy, it’s normal to wonder what the experience will be like. Prenatal chiropractic visits are gentle, personalized, and adapted to your stage of pregnancy.

Here’s what typically happens:

1. Initial Evaluation

Your Dunwoody prenatal chiropractor will ask about your symptoms, pregnancy progress, and medical history. They may evaluate your posture, pelvis, and spinal alignment.

2. Gentle Adjustments

You’ll lie on a pregnancy-safe table or pillow system that supports your belly without pressure. Adjustments are light and controlled.

3. Stretching and Muscle Work

Some chiropractors use soft tissue techniques to ease tension in the round ligaments, hips, or lower back.

4. Recommendations for Home Care

Your chiropractor may suggest stretches, ergonomic tips, or strengthening exercises to enhance your results.

Most women visit weekly or biweekly, depending on their symptoms and trimester.

When Should Pregnant Women Avoid Chiropractic Care?

Although chiropractic care is safe for most pregnancies, there are certain high-risk conditions that require caution. You should consult your OBGYN before visiting a chiropractor if you have:

  • Vaginal bleeding

  • Placenta previa or placental abruption

  • Severe toxemia

  • Sudden or severe abdominal pain or cramping

  • Premature labor concerns

  • Any condition requiring medical supervision

A responsible chiropractor will always refer you back to your healthcare provider if chiropractic care is not appropriate for your situation.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why should I have chiropractic care during pregnancy?

Chiropractic care helps relieve back, hip, and pelvic pain caused by the physical changes of pregnancy. It improves pelvic alignment, posture, and mobility. Many women find it a safe, drug-free way to stay comfortable as their body grows.

How often should I see a chiropractor during pregnancy?

Most women benefit from weekly or biweekly visits, depending on their symptoms. In the first trimester, visits may be less frequent, but appointments typically increase in the second and third trimesters. Your chiropractor will tailor the schedule to your needs.

Can you receive chiropractic care throughout all trimesters of pregnancy?

Yes, chiropractic care is safe in all trimesters when performed by a trained prenatal chiropractor. Adjustments are modified as your belly grows to keep you and your baby comfortable. Many women receive care right up until delivery, and depending on the setting, during labor itself.

Can chiropractic care help position a breech baby (or help with fetal positioning)?

Chiropractors don’t turn breech babies, but the Webster Technique helps balance the pelvis and soft tissues, which may create more room for the baby to move into an optimal position. It supports natural fetal positioning but is not a guaranteed correction for breech presentation. Many have found success with this Technique, and avoided unnecessary c-sections.

Will chiropractic care affect the baby?

No, prenatal chiropractic care does not negatively affect the baby. Techniques avoid pressure on the abdomen and use gentle, pregnancy-safe adjustments. Many women report increased comfort and mobility without risks to the baby.
